genBRDF: Discovering New Analytic BRDFs with Genetic Programming

被引:35
作者
Brady, Adam [1 ]
Lawrence, Jason [1 ]
Peers, Pieter [2 ]
Weimer, Westley [1 ]
机构
[1] Univ Virginia, Charlottesville, VA 22903 USA
[2] Coll William & Mary, Williamsburg, VA 23187 USA
来源
ACM TRANSACTIONS ON GRAPHICS | 2014年 / 33卷 / 04期
基金
美国国家科学基金会;
关键词
BRDF; isotropic; analytic; genetic programming; REFLECTANCE;
D O I
10.1145/2601097.2601193
中图分类号
TP31 [计算机软件];
学科分类号
081202 ; 0835 ;
摘要
We present a framework for learning new analytic BRDF models through Genetic Programming that we call genBRDF. This approach to reflectance modeling can be seen as an extension of traditional methods that rely either on a phenomenological or empirical process. Our technique augments the human effort involved in deriving mathematical expressions that accurately characterize complex high-dimensional reflectance functions through a large-scale optimization. We present a number of analysis tools and data visualization techniques that are crucial to sifting through the large result sets produced by genBRDF in order to identify fruitful expressions. Additionally, we highlight several new models found by genBRDF that have not previously appeared in the BRDF literature. These new BRDF models are compact and more accurate than current state-of-the-art alternatives.
引用
收藏
页数:11
相关论文
共 29 条
[1]  
Andalon-Garcia I. R., 2012, 2012 22nd International Conference on Electrical Communications and Computers (CONIELECOMP 2012), P1, DOI 10.1109/CONIELECOMP.2012.6189871
[2]  
[Anonymous], DIGITAL MODELING MAT
[3]  
[Anonymous], 2005, EUROGRAPHICS S RENDE, DOI [DOI 10.2312/EGWR/EGSR05/117-1261,2,8, DOI 10.2312/EGWR/EGSR05/117-126]
[4]  
[Anonymous], 2007, Compilers: principles, techniques and tools
[5]  
[Anonymous], 2003, Genetic programming IV: routine human-competitive machine intelligence
[6]  
[Anonymous], 1982, ACM T GRAPHIC, DOI DOI 10.1145/357290.357293
[7]  
Ashikhmin M, 2000, COMP GRAPH, P65, DOI 10.1145/344779.344814
[8]   Accurate fitting of measured reflectances using a Shifted Gamma micro-facet distribution [J].
Bagher, M. M. ;
Soler, C. ;
Holzschuch, N. .
COMPUTER GRAPHICS FORUM, 2012, 31 (04) :1509-1518
[9]  
Beckmann P., 1963, INT SERIES MONOGRAPH
[10]  
Blinn J. F., 1977, ACM SIGGRAPH COMPUTE, P192, DOI DOI 10.1145/965141.563893